Open Campus Partners with Government of Madhya Pradesh and Geeks of Gurukul to Digitize 50 Million Academic Records

BHOPAL, India, Jan 9 (Bernama-GLOBE NEWSWIRE) —Open Campus, the community-led decentralized autonomous organization (DAO) building the blockchain-powered financial layer for education, today announced it has entered into a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the government of Madhya Pradesh and Geeks of Gurukul to digitize the state of Madhya Pradesh’s 50 million student and graduate academic records.

The digitization initiative will be overseen over the next 18 months by a joint steering committee representing Open Campus, the government of Madhya Pradesh and Geeks of Gurukule. Open Campus will provide the underlying infrastructure to create verifiable digital credentials for the students and graduates of universities in Madhya Pradesh.
